Sheila Bloom, MS
Research Coordinator

Ms. Sheila Bloom is a research coordinator, working with Dr. James Perrin and other colleagues on two research projects, “Improving Medical Homes for Children with Chronic Conditions” and “Establishing an Evidence Base for Systems of Care for CYSHCN.” She is also an Editorial Associate for Ambulatory Pediatrics, the official journal of the Ambulatory Pediatric Association. She has many years experience in researching policies and programs serving children with special health care needs and co-authored the book, “Home and Community Care for Chronically Ill Children” with Dr. Perrin and Ms. May Shayne. She was educated at Wellesley College, Harvard School of Public Health, and Brandeis University Heller School for Social Policy and Management.
